Restaurants offering Bbq Bite Size
Search city
Menu
Menu
City: New Orleans, 5941 Bullard Avenue, New Orleans, 70128, United States Of America
The restaurant from New Orleans offers 34 different meals and drinks on the card at an average price of $10.7.
Price
The Average price for Bbq Bite Size is:
$6.8
Feedback
These reviews refer only to the mentioned ingredients.